MMMMM----- Recipe via Meal-Master (tm) v8.05

     Title: Pull Apart Sticky Bun
Categories: Tested, Easy
     Yield: 6 Servings

   1/4 c  Chopped pecans
   1/2 c  Sugar
     1 ts Ground cinnamon
    11 oz Refrigerated breadsticks
     6 tb Melted butter

MMMMM--------------------------DRIZZLE-------------------------------
     6 tb Powdered sugar
   1/2 ts Vanilla
     1 tb Water (or more)

 Preheat oven to 350.

 Combine pecans, sugar and cinnamon in a med mixing bowl and mix well.

 Unroll the breadstick dough and separate into 12 strips.

 Dip each strip in the butter and coat with the pecan mixture.

 Starting at the center of a round 2 quart baking dish (I used 8 inch
 round cake pan) loosely  arrange the strips in a spiral fashion to
 form a circle.

 Sprinkle with any remaining pecan mixture.

 Bake for 20 minutes or until golden brown.  Cool in p an for 5
 minutes.

 Invert onto serving platter.

 Variation of recipe from Pampered Chef Cookbook

 Tested - very nice.

 Will try using 1 lb bread dough from bread machine instead of ready
 made dough.
